Output 8b8a0a0f025f7b15d16a696a38da976f684c604b0470798016fcbf781b3a013d:1

value
2343007412
script pubkey
OP_HASH160 OP_PUSHBYTES_20 66c789e55ea8f1ad1eabff3a1496e6f86b57553f OP_EQUAL
address
3B4TtJKEqVhK1Y9Yo2BHQfFwwVZdfFU52S
transaction
8b8a0a0f025f7b15d16a696a38da976f684c604b0470798016fcbf781b3a013d
spent
true